sql中添加数据的命令
在SQL中,添加数据通常使用INSERT INTO
语句。以下是一个基本的示例:
INSERT INTO 表名称 (列1, 列2, 列3, ...)
VALUES (值1, 值2, 值3, ...);
如果你要为表中的所有列添加数据,可以省略列名称,但必须保证值的顺序与表中列的顺序相匹配:
INSERT INTO 表名称
VALUES (值1, 值2, 值3, ...);
例如,假设我们有一个名为students
的表,它有三列:id
, name
, 和 age
。我们要添加一个新的学生记录:
INSERT INTO students (id, name, age)
VALUES (1, '张三', 20);
如果你要一次性添加多条记录,可以使用以下语法:
INSERT INTO 表名称 (列1, 列2, 列3, ...)
VALUES (值1a, 值2a, 值3a, ...),
(值1b, 值2b, 值3b, ...),
...
(值1n, 值2n, 值3n, ...);
例如:
INSERT INTO students (id, name, age)
VALUES (2, '李四', 22),
(3, '王五', 23),
(4, '赵六', 24);
评论已关闭